Description

Description

Tris-Acetate-EDTA, CAS Number-77-86-1, 60-00-4, 6850-28-8, TAE, 4L, Gray, Tris (24%), Acetic Acid (5.0%), and EDTA (<2%)., DNase free, Pass Test, Filtered through a 0.2-micron filter., Electrophoresis, 50X Solution, Poly CUBE, Liquid, Protease free, DNase-, RNase- and Protease-Free, RT

Tris–Acetate–EDTA (TAE) is commonly used as a buffer for nucleic acid electrophoresis.
